Python Program for cube sum of first n natural numbers Last Updated : 24 Feb, 2025 Comments Improve Suggest changes Like Article Like Report We are given a number n and we need to print the sum of series 13 + 23 + 33 + 43 + .......+ n3 till the n-th term in python.Examples:Input: n = 5Output: 225Explanation: 13 + 23 + 33 + 43 + 53 = 225Let's discuss some of the ways to do it.Using Mathematical Formula: Most efficient solution is to use the direct mathematical formula which is (n ( n + 1 ) / 2) ^ 2, where n is the number of terms. Python n = 5 res = ((n * (n + 1)) // 2) ** 2 print(res) Output225 Explanation: ((n * (n + 1)) // 2) ** 2 gives us the sum of cubes of integers from 1 to n.Table of ContentUsing Brute Force approachUsing list comprehensionUsing Enumerate ListUsing Brute Force approachWe can iterate from 1 to n, computing the cube of each number and summing them, where n is the limit up to which the sum is required. Python n = 5 sum = 0 for i in range(1, n + 1): res += i ** 3 print(res) Output225 Explanation: iterate from 1 to n using for loop and sum += i**3, keeps on adding the the cubes of the numbers.Using generator expressionUse generator expression to generate a list of cubes for numbers from 1 to n, then apply the sum() function to get the total. This approach is concise and efficient, combining iteration and summation in a single line. Python n = 5 res = sum(i**3 for i in range(1, n + 1)) print(res) Output225 Explanation: i**3 for i in range(1, n + 1) creates a list of cubes of numbers from 1 to n and then sum() function returns the sum of all the elements inside the list.Using Enumerate ListIn this approach, we will use the enumerate list to find the cube sum of n natural numbers in one line. Python n = 5 res = sum([(i+1) ** 3 for i, _ in enumerate(range(n))]) print(res) Output225 Explanation: use list comprehension with enumerate(range(n)) to generate cubes of numbers from 1 to n.apply the sum() function to compute the total sum of cubes.underscore (_) in enumerate() is a throwaway variable since enumerate(range(n)) returns both index and value, but only the index (i) is used.
